Box sets make it hard to avoid binge watching

By Rick Bentley

The Fresno Bee

    ORDER REPRINT →

July 08, 2015 06:31 PM

DVD sets featuring a full year or the entire run of a TV series can be entertaining. Here’s a couple that do work and one that is so-so.

“Married With Children — The Complete Series”: The Fox Network owes its existence to this irreverent comedy that launched in 1987. The sitcom and “The Tracey Ullman Show” were the first primetime programs for the network.

The show’s comedy was raw (especially for the time) and very funny. It should be in your collection as both a good TV series and for its historical value.

“Archie Bunker’s Place: Season 1”: “All in the Family” was a ground-breaking series in how it found comedy in some very sensitive areas. The spin-off series lost a lot of the edge and eventually just became a place for Carroll O’Connor to keep playing the title character.

“Playing House: Season 1”: The cable comedy works because of the two stars: Lennon Parham and Jessica St. Clair.

Parham plays the more stable one of the two best friends, who is on the verge of having her first baby. St. Clair is the jet-setting business wiz who is on the verge of her first martini of the day. This is both a fun show about parenthood and strong women.
